Moss poles provide support for many climbing houseplants, mimicking their natural growth habits by offering a surface for aerial roots to anchor. A PVC pipe moss pole is a practical, durable DIY solution. It uses a PVC pipe core enveloped by mesh filled with moisture-retaining material like sphagnum moss, promoting healthier growth and larger foliage for vining plants.
Why Use a PVC Pipe Moss Pole?
Choosing PVC for a moss pole offers several distinct advantages. PVC is durable and resistant to rot, unlike wooden stakes that can degrade in moist conditions. Its non-porous nature also means it will not harbor pests or fungi as readily as organic materials. PVC pipes are cost-effective and widely available.
The rigid structure provides stability for large, mature climbing plants. Customization is a key benefit, as PVC pipes can be easily cut to desired lengths or extended as a plant grows taller. This adaptability ensures the support system evolves with the plant, providing continuous upward growth. Its longevity means a well-constructed PVC moss pole can last for many years, reducing frequent replacements.
Gathering Your Materials
To construct a PVC pipe moss pole, gather these specific items:
A PVC pipe (1 to 1.5 inches in diameter) for the central support.
Sturdy mesh material (e.g., hardware cloth with 1/4 inch grid or plastic garden mesh) to hold the moss.
Long-fiber sphagnum moss for water retention, providing necessary moisture for aerial roots.
Heavy-duty scissors or wire cutters for the mesh.
A saw for cutting the PVC pipe to your desired height.
Zip ties or strong, rot-resistant fishing line to secure the mesh.
A funnel or similar tool for easily filling the moss between the pipe and mesh.
Step-by-Step Assembly
Cut and Prepare
Cut your PVC pipe to the desired height for your moss pole, allowing at least 6-12 inches for pot insertion and stability. Next, measure and cut your mesh material. The mesh should be long enough to wrap around the PVC pipe with a slight overlap and tall enough to match the pipe’s height, creating a cylindrical casing.
Form and Secure Mesh
Once cut, form the mesh into a snug cylinder around the PVC pipe. Secure the mesh edges together using zip ties or fishing line, spaced every few inches along the seam. Ensure the mesh is tightly bound to prevent moss from spilling out. Leave one end open for filling.
Hydrate and Fill Moss
Hydrate your sphagnum moss by submerging it in water until fully saturated, then gently squeeze out excess until damp but not dripping. This ensures the moss provides moisture for your plant’s aerial roots. Pack small handfuls of the damp moss into the space between the PVC pipe and the mesh casing.
Continue to fill firmly and evenly, working your way up. A narrow funnel or rolled paper can assist in guiding the moss. Once the mesh cylinder is packed tightly, secure the top end with additional zip ties or fishing line. This completes the assembly, preparing it for plant integration.
Integrating Your Plant
Once assembled, introduce your climbing plant to its new support. Insert the bottom end of the PVC pipe into the plant’s pot, ensuring it is deeply anchored for stability. Position the pole close to the main stem without damaging the root system, encouraging upward growth. Gently guide the plant’s main stem and any existing aerial roots towards the moss pole.
Secure the stem loosely with soft plant ties, twine, or reusable velcro strips designed for plants. Avoid tying too tightly, as this can restrict growth or damage the stem. Regularly mist the moss on the pole to encourage aerial roots to seek out and adhere to the moist surface. As the plant grows, continue to gently guide new growth onto the pole, ensuring new aerial roots have access to the damp moss.
Maintaining Your Moss Pole
Maintaining your PVC pipe moss pole involves keeping the sphagnum moss moist. Regularly mist the moss or gently pour water down the top of the pole to saturate it. Keeping the moss consistently damp is crucial for encouraging aerial root attachment and provides hydration to the plant. Watering frequency depends on your home’s humidity and the moss’s ability to retain moisture.
As your plant grows taller, it may outgrow the initial height of your moss pole. PVC pipe moss poles can be easily extended. Simply attach another section of PVC pipe and a new moss-filled mesh cylinder to the top of the existing pole. This ensures continuous support for your plant’s upward development. Regularly check the ties securing the plant to the pole, loosening or adjusting them as the stem thickens to prevent girdling.
